Job Description
The Quality/Safety Manager for Surgical Specialty and Spine (S3) ICCE reports to the Quality and Safety Program Director for Surgical and Support Services and works collaboratively with the S3 ICCE Leadership at MUSC. Under limited supervision, the Quality/Safety Manager provides full support to the QAPI/safety program for their respective ICCE. This includes collecting relevant quality data, analyzing and assessing data, working with relevant stakeholders on disseminating data and information, benchmarking performance, and leading multidisciplinary teams to improve performance based on goals. This position collects and presents performance to relevant oversight and governance groups. This position leads and oversees all QAPI and regulatory/accreditation activities for Specialty Surgery and Spine ICCE. The Quality/Safety manager also monitors and collates patient safety events in collaboration with the operational leaders and works with the Risk management department to facilitate event reviews and appropriate after review actions. The manager will work with ICCE leadership to collect, monitor, track, and improve patient-reported outcome measures (PROMs).
Additional Job Description
Bachelor’s degree in a health-related field and a minimum of five (5) years of experience with strong knowledge in quality and performance improvement or a master’s degree in a health-related field and 3 years of healthcare experience with strong knowledge in quality and performance improvement. Certification as Certified Professional in Healthcare Quality or Patient Safety preferred. Computer/Internet skills and familiarity with MS Off ice products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Access, etc.) essential. Experience with LEAN/Six Sigma and certification in Six Sigma preferred. Experience with Just Culture required, certification preferred. Experience with Epic EMR preferred. Surgical and/or Ambulatory medical experience preferred.
